What is ACL Tear?
The ACL, or Anterior Cruciate Ligament, is a strong band of tissue inside your knee that helps keep it stable. An ACL tear happens when this ligament is stretched too far or torn, often during sports or sudden movements that twist the knee. This injury can make your knee feel unstable and painful.
Symptoms & Warning Signs
- Sudden sharp pain in the knee during activity or twisting motion.
- A popping sound at the time of injury is common.
- Swelling develops quickly within hours of the injury.
- Difficulty walking or putting weight on the leg due to pain or weakness.
- Knee feels unstable or “gives out” when you try to stand or move.
- Limited range of motion, making it hard to fully bend or straighten the knee.
- Tenderness around the knee joint, especially along the ligament area.
⚠️ Emergency Warning Signs:
- Severe swelling within a few hours
- Intense pain that does not improve with rest
- Inability to move or bear any weight on the knee
If you experience these, seek immediate medical attention.
When to See a Doctor
You should see an orthopaedic specialist if your knee hurts after an injury, especially if you hear a pop or notice swelling. If your knee feels unstable or you cannot walk without pain, do not delay consultation. Early diagnosis and treatment can help prevent further damage and improve recovery outcomes.
Treatment Options
- Non-surgical treatment: Includes rest, ice, compression, and elevation (RICE), along with physical therapy to strengthen muscles and improve knee stability. This option is usually for mild tears or less active patients.
- Minimally invasive surgery: Arthroscopic ACL reconstruction uses small incisions and a camera to repair or replace the torn ligament. This approach reduces healing time and scarring.
- Open surgery: In rare cases, a larger incision is used for complex injuries or combined ligament repairs.

The ACL Tear Procedure
Before Surgery:
Your doctor will perform a physical exam and imaging tests like an MRI to confirm the tear. Pre-surgery preparation includes discussing your medical history, stopping certain medications, and planning post-surgery rehabilitation.
During Surgery:
Under general or regional anesthesia, the surgeon removes the torn ligament and replaces it with a graft, usually taken from your own hamstring or patellar tendon. The procedure typically lasts 1–2 hours using arthroscopic tools through small cuts around the knee.
After Surgery:
You will be moved to recovery and monitored. Pain management and early movement exercises begin quickly. A detailed rehabilitation program is essential to regain strength and motion.
Recovery & Timeline
| Week | Recovery Stage | What to Expect |
|---|---|---|
| 1-2 | Initial healing and pain control | Use crutches, swelling reduces, gentle movement |
| 3-6 | Early rehabilitation | Begin physical therapy, improve range of motion |
| 7-12 | Strengthening phase | Increase muscle exercises, start weight-bearing |
| 13-16 | Advanced rehab | Balance and agility training, return to daily activities |
| 17-24 | Full recovery and return to sports | Gradual return to sports under supervision |
Following your surgeon’s advice and attending all physiotherapy sessions is key to a successful recovery.

Frequently Asked Questions
What causes an ACL tear most often?
ACL tears usually happen during sports or activities that involve sudden stops, jumps, or changes in direction. Common causes include football, basketball, and accidental falls.
Can an ACL tear heal without surgery?
Mild ACL injuries can sometimes be managed with physical therapy and rest. However, a complete tear often requires surgery to restore knee stability, especially for active people.
How long does ACL reconstruction surgery take?
The surgery usually takes about 1 to 2 hours and is performed under anesthesia. Recovery planning begins immediately after surgery.
Will I be able to play sports again after ACL surgery?
With proper rehabilitation, many patients return to sports within 6 months. Your doctor and physiotherapist will guide you on when it’s safe to resume specific activities.
Is ACL surgery painful?
Post-surgery pain is managed with medications and reduces within a few weeks. Physical therapy helps ease stiffness and improves movement gradually.
